 Tapered bearings do not work very well in the TR7/8 5 speed so I would not=
 expect much better in the TR3-6 box. Why not chuck the lay gear in your la=
the, bore out the hole a little deeper and make a long bronze oil-lite bear=
ing for it? I have done this dozens of time with no problems. Also mich the=
 replacement lay shaft as the ones for MGBs are .0025" too small!

Just to clarify, the problem is on both 4 speed and 4 speed O/D transmissio=
ns.Every failure I encounter is with the caged needle bearings not the loos=
e needle bearings in the very early transmissions. The last few years I hav=
e been rebuilding many TR3 and TR4 Transmissions. The bearing shell (that h=
olds the needles in place) works/walks along the shaft and forces itself in=
to the small thrust washer that is near the smaller 1st gear. The shell wil=
l then fracture into pieces and the remaining will dig into the thrust wash=
er and then the case if not removed soon enough.The caged bearing shells ar=
e available through Moss but the problem is getting that laygear out of the=
 transmission case. As I stated earlier, to remove the laygear ( after the =
shaft is removed ) the small thrust washer needs to be removed so the layge=
ar can tilt and worked out of the case. When the bearing shell machines its=
 way into the thrust washer its almost impossible to get it out. Then you h=
ave a scrap case on your hands.Glenn with 2 n's
